【技术实现步骤摘要】
本专利技术涉及一种基于移动锚节点的传感器网络节点定位方法,更涉及到随机移动技术与无线测距技木。
技术介绍
无线传感器网络由部署在监测区域内大量的廉价微型传感器节点组成,通过无线 通信方式形成ー个多跳的自组织网络系统,协作地感知、采集和处理网络覆盖区域中感知对象的信息,并发送给观察者,对传感器网络节点进行准确定位是实现上述目标的前提。普通节点由于结构简单计算能力差,能量有限,所以不能完全自主完成定位。按是否需要锚节点參与辅助定位划分,现有定位算法分为基于锚节点定位算法和无需锚节点定位算法,而目前采用的锚节点成本高,不能大量使用,导致对未知节点覆盖率低,从而使得节点在定位过程中无法获得足够的信息引起较大的定位误差。
技术实现思路
本专利技术主要解决传统锚节点成本高,覆盖率低,现有定位算法复杂且定位误差大的问题。本专利技术解决上述问题采用的技术方案为采用移动锚节点产生虚拟锚节点代替传统的锚节点,解决了使用大量锚节点成本高的问题,并借助高斯马尔科夫移动模型,采用控制技术使得锚节点按照优化之后的移动路径进行移动,锚节点通过发送即时位置信号通知周围的未知节点,同时未知节点通过RSSI技术测得自身与虚拟锚节点之间的距离。待测节点在完成自身定位过程中,增加靠近自身的虚拟锚节点的权重,通过加权质心算法实现自身定位。从而得到一种成本低,覆盖率高,算法简单,误差小的节点定位方法。附图说明图I是本专利技术方法中锚节点移动路径优化流程图;图2是锚节点实际移动过程中停留位置与系统生成目的点之间误差示意图;β表示实际移动偏离模型生成方向的角度;d表示实际停留位置偏离目的点的距离;图3是虚 ...
【技术保护点】
【技术特征摘要】
1.一种基于移动锚节点的无线传感器网络节点加权质心定位方法,其特征在于它的步骤如下 步骤ー完成传感器网络节点布撒,节点处于睡眠状态; 步骤ニ 将带有GPS定位设备的锚节点安装在可控移动装置上,进入待测区域; 步骤三移动装置在向下ー个目的点移动前,预先判断此目的点与之前储存的历史坐标位置之间的距离,只有在该距离大于设定的值时移动装置认为此目的点有效,并开始移动,否则重新生成目的点,直至目的点有效; 步骤四移动锚节点在待测区域内移动,每移动ー个设定周期便停下来,通过GPS获得即时坐标位置,并将信息储存在自身内存中,同时以一定通信半径向四周广播信息,广播完成后继续向如移动; 锚节点通过移动模型生成下ー个周期的转弯角度,移动速度与移动目的点,按上述三组參数移动,由于移动装置转弯角度,移动速度误差的存在,导致自身停止的位置与实际生成的位置存在误差,此时抛弃模型生成的坐标点,保存并发送GPS測定的值。步骤五未知节点被唤醒后接收锚节点发送的坐标信息,同时通过RS...
【专利技术属性】
技术研发人员:沈艳霞,薛小松,赵芝璞,吴定会,潘庭龙,纪志成,
申请(专利权)人:江南大学,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。